Seeking Funding For Your Next Big Media Project? Creative Europe Is Reopening Applications For 2025

The Creative Europe MEDIA programme will be reopening its applications for 2025, allowing creators, producers and organisations within the audiovisual community across the entire continent to submit their projects, opening new opportunities for collaboration.

The cross-border programme brings forward a plethora of funding opportunities for those projects that have been dying to see the light of day. Applicants can expect financial assistance in relation to the development and production of fiction, creative, documentary, animation projects and even the development of narrative video games.

For the more business side of things, Creative Europe will also be initiating funding calls for ‘Innovative Tools and Business Models’ as well as ‘Skills and Talents Development.’

However, the support doesn’t end at just the inner workings of the audiovisual industry, along with these initiatives, audiovisual enthusiasts can hone their practical and promotional skills with the ‘Audience Development and audiovisual Education’ call, featuring others alongside it that aid in the organisation of European Festivals.
